Installation

Unlike built-in ethanol fireplaces, wall mounted fires do not require any frame work to be installed in your home. Instead, they can be simply installed on the wall with either an eagle or a firebox, which is then fitted on to the wall. To install one of these fires, you will first must select the best place to put it in. You should ensure that the fire is placed away from materials that could ignite in accordance with the manufacturer's guidelines. If it is possible, also make sure that the location is near enough to an outlet to allow the power cord to reach.

Installing a fireplace may require different steps depending on the type you choose. Certain models require that you attach the firebox to a bracket, which is then connected to your wall. Others require fixing the firebox directly on the wall. You should refer to the instruction included with your fireplace to get more details on this.

It is crucial to follow all instructions for installation that come with your fireplace, since this will prevent any accidents or damage. If you're not confident in doing the installation yourself, you could hire a professional to do it for you. They'll know exactly how to do and will ensure that your fireplace is installed properly.

For gas wall-mounted fireplaces you'll need to take additional precautions as they generate a lot heat and require adequate ventilation. Be aware of BTU output since certain models can only be used in certain rooms and at certain levels.

Always be sure to check the ceiling's height prior to purchasing a gas fireplace. This will determine whether you are able to utilize a model with no vents or if it is necessary to purchase a vented model.

If you intend to mount your fireplace on drywall ensure that the wall can support it. Utilize a stud identifier to find wall studs. If you can't find any studs in the wall, you'll have to reinforce the wall prior to installing your fireplace. You should also ask someone to help you install your fireplace because it can be heavy.

Safety

Wall-mounted fireplaces can be a beautiful feature for any house. However, they come with certain safety concerns. If you adhere to certain guidelines, you can safely use these fireplaces. These guidelines are applicable to electric and gas models.

Electric ethanol fireplaces should be placed at least 3 feet from flammable materials to prevent fire dangers. This includes furniture, bedding paper, clothing and curtains. It is also important to keep them from children and pets. Install a firescreen to reduce the risk of accidents.

The brackets used to mount the fireplace to the wall need to be securely anchored to the studs behind the drywall. If the mounting brackets are not secure, they could come crashing down when you use them. This is important because it is not only dangerous and could cause damage to the fireplace or wall.

If you are using an electric fireplace with a heating feature it is essential to plug it into an additional outlet with 230 Volts. This will ensure that other devices are not plugged into the same outlet. Otherwise, the circuit may overheat and cause electrical fire.

Avoid placing liquids or drinks near your electric fireplace. These liquids may corrode metal parts, resulting in an unsafe environment. Also, ensure that you don't place your fireplace close to paints, gasoline, or flammable liquids. Also, keep any cords out of the way to avoid tripping or falling hazards.

When installing your new fireplace, it is essential to read the directions given by the manufacturer. Also, you should test your fireplace prior to completing the installation. This is particularly important if you have small children. This will protect your family from burns caused by accident.
